Best time to go to Big Bend

Visitor numbers in Big Bend is generally unchanged in popularity throughout the year. The best time to visit Big Bend can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Big Bend falls in July,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is sunny with no rain. The coolest average temperature in Big Bend falls in December,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with moderate r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January36.1°F (2.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
February37.4°F (3.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
March40.1°F (4.5°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
April47.3°F (8.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
May55.9°F (13.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June65.5°F (18.6°C)No Rain (Dry)S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
July74.7°F (23.7°C)No Rain (Dry)S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
August72.7°F (22.6°C)No Rain (Dry)S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
September65.1°F (18.4°C)No Rain (Dry)SunnyAverageAverage
October53.6°F (12.0°C)Light RainSunnyAverageAverage
November41.5°F (5.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
December34.9°F (1.6°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age

What is the best area to stay in Big Bend?
The best area to stay in Big Bend is the area near the Big Bend Hot Springs, particularly around the small community of Big Bend itself.

This area is the primary hub for visitors looking to experience the region's natural hot springs and outdoor activities. It's located along the Pit River and surrounded by the Shasta-Trinity National Forest, offering a tranquil setting. The main attractions are the natural geothermal pools, which are accessible to the public.

For couples seeking a relaxing retreat, staying near the Big Bend Hot Springs provides direct access to these soothing waters. It's an ideal spot for unwinding and enjoying the natural surroundings, with opportunities for quiet walks along the river or simply soaking in the springs.

For those who enjoy fishing and a more rustic outdoor experience, the areas slightly outside the immediate Big Bend community, closer to the Pit River, offer cabins and lodges that cater to these interests.
